Swedish Massage is one of the most common types of massage therapy. It is done with lotions or oils and long, flowing strokes with light to medium pressure. This massage is great for those who do not like a lot of pressure and are looking to decompress and relax! The main goals of this modality are relaxation, increased blood circulation, decreased stress, and relieved pain.
Deep-tissue massage is a form of bodywork that works below the superficial layers of tissue. The massage therapist will use firm pressure and slow strokes to be able to target chronic muscle tension and adhesions. This modality is great for helping to relieve pain and discomfort from injuries or overuse, as well as restoring muscle movement.
Due to the nature of this modality, there will be an increase in communication in order to keep you safe and comfortable during your massage. Bruising and soreness are possible, and it is recommended that you drink water and relax after receiving it.

In addition to the usual health benefits of massage, another benefit of chair massage is that it is done over clothing. With seated massage, you can avoid the discomfort and awkwardness that you may feel in disrobing for a traditional massage. Also, chair massage sessions are usually shorter than traditional massage, making it convenient enough to fit into your busy schedule.
